From 2 years ago: So has this app joined the lamentable iOS7 trend toward form over function, disappearing buttons, weird colors, and excessive blank space? Perhaps, but note that in settings you can largely overcome it by selecting a return to the old color icons. In a significant functional improvement, the new iPad version now puts almost everything on one page with a split screen for individual entry details— a welcome departure from the silly trend toward more page levels and more empty white space. I don't like it that there is no button or other clue for copying an item like the password. You have to guess that tapping the item will copy it. The garish turquoise edit button is almost illegible. The cost for the non-essential new photo/custom icon option, however, is trivial. This is on balance still a great app, and I don't begrudge the developers getting a little more for it through an optional in-app purchase.

Update 4/25/17: mSeven used to be the "good guys." They put out a no-nonsense tool with the right feature set for a reasonable, fixed price. Users had a choice of backup options. Sync just worked over Wifi. No need for subscriptions, cloud servers, user accounts or other unwanted baggage. I said in my review below that I hoped mSeven never "sold out." Well, it took a long time, but sadly that time has arrived. With the new version, you'll have to create an account with them and upload all of your passwords to their server in order to sync across your devices. It appears the flexible backup options are also being removed or severely restricted. All while being charged again for the privilege. There is now nothing separating mSecure from the other tools in this space. Bummer. Let's hope another company with integrity moves in to fill the void left by this "upgrade".
